WebFor adults, a healthy weight is defined as the appropriate body weight in relation to height. This ratio of weight to height is known as the body mass index (BMI). People who are overweight (BMI of 25–29.9) have too much body weight for their height. People who are obese (BMI of 30 or above) almost always have a large amount of body fat in ...

WebBMI is an estimate of body fat and a good gauge of your risk for diseases that can occur with more body fat.
